Highest Paid Female TikToker in Nigeria
Mercy Eke is a prominent Nigerian social media personality and reality TV star who gained widespread recognition through her participation in the Big Brother Naija (BBNaija) reality show. After winning the fourth season of BBNaija, she leveraged her newfound fame to build a strong presence on TikTok, where she quickly amassed a substantial following.
As of recent reports, Mercy Eke's TikTok account boasts millions of followers. This extensive reach has not only increased her influence but has also significantly boosted her earning potential. Her content ranges from entertaining skits and dance routines to lifestyle and beauty tips, all of which resonate with a broad audience. Her ability to engage viewers and create relatable content has contributed to her high earnings on the platform.
Several factors contribute to Mercy Eke's position as the highest-paid female TikToker in Nigeria:
Large Following: Mercy Eke's TikTok account attracts millions of followers, making her one of the most influential figures on the platform in Nigeria. The larger the following, the higher the potential for earnings through brand collaborations, sponsorships, and advertisements.
Brand Partnerships: Mercy has successfully partnered with various brands to promote their products and services. These partnerships often include sponsored posts and advertisements, which are a significant source of income for TikTok influencers.
Content Creation: Mercy Eke's engaging and high-quality content not only attracts a large audience but also keeps viewers coming back for more. Her creativity and consistency in content creation help maintain high engagement rates, which are crucial for maximizing earnings on TikTok.
Diverse Revenue Streams: Beyond TikTok, Mercy Eke's presence in the entertainment industry, including endorsements and appearances, contributes to her overall income. This diversified approach helps her capitalize on various revenue opportunities.
